Custom Content Type Manager
Bug in get_custom_field_meta and get_custom_field_def (2 posts)

  1. GreyhoundXX
    Posted 3 years ago #

    I've worked my way around this, but just wanted to let you know that get_custom_field_meta() doesn't single out one field, it gets everything for that custom field. It does what get_custom_field_def() is supposed to do, I think.

    On the other hand, get_custom_field_def gives me this error:

    Fatal error: Call to undefined function get_custom_field_def()


  2. fireproofsocks
    Plugin Contributor

    Posted 3 years ago #

    Ah, you're right, thanks for catching that... I've updated the functions file -- my intention was to merge the 2 functions because they are so similar, but I probably got distracted when I was working on that and I neglected to update the wiki. The wiki has been updated now: http://code.google.com/p/wordpress-custom-content-type-manager/wiki/get_custom_field_meta

    So in your includes/functions.php file, the get_custom_field_meta() function should look like this:

    function get_custom_field_meta($fieldname, $item=null) {
    	$data = get_option( CCTM::db_key, array() );
    	if (isset($data['custom_field_defs'][$fieldname])) {
    		if ($item && isset($data['custom_field_defs'][$fieldname][$item])) {
    			return $data['custom_field_defs'][$fieldname][$item];
    		else {
    			return $data['custom_field_defs'][$fieldname]
    	else {
    		return sprintf( __('Invalid field name: %s', CCTM_TXTDOMAIN), $fieldname );

    This fix will be in

    Just a reminder to please file a bugs in the bug tracker: http://code.google.com/p/wordpress-custom-content-type-manager/issues/list

    if they're not in the bug-tracker, then there's no guarantee they'll get fixed, and if they do happen to get fixed, there's no record of them.

Topic Closed

This topic has been closed to new replies.

About this Plugin

About this Topic